Undersized flowers will help to create an original composition in a flower bed. They can be the basis of the composition, a border-fence or a background for tall flowers.
There are undersized flowering flowers and non-flowering plants that have decorative shoots, leaves and unusual colors. An excellent option is a combination of these species.

plant species
There are perennials, annuals, and biennials.
perennial plants
Perennial undersized flowers are planted once, and then delight the eye with their beauty for several years. This saves time, effort and money. In addition, weeds cannot break through from under dense tubers. However, perennials gradually lose their decorative effect, so an update is required (about once every 5-7 years).
Astrantia is large. The height of the plant does not exceed 70 cm. It can grow in any soil. Spreading astrantia bushes are covered with white, pink or burgundy flowers. There are representatives with inflorescences of different shades on the same shoot.
It is necessary to remove wilted flowers in time so that the plant has the strength to give new ones. Astrantia «loves» the sun, a place with a loose shadow is also suitable.
Oak sage. The second name of this undersized flower is salvia. Bushes are low and compact. Sage blooms throughout the summer.
The inflorescences are long purple candles, which looks very impressive. Suitable for planting shaded areas with moist soil.
Alyssum sea. Like most perennials, it belongs to the flowers that bloom all summer. Alyssum inflorescences are able to withstand even the first frost.
In regions with a warm year-round climate, it does not die off, and in cold climates there is no need to shelter it. Colors of flowers are various: white, yellow, pink, lilac.
Duchenea Indian feels good in any soil, but requires constant soil moisture. The sun-loving plant grows rapidly, covering the soil with a dense carpet. The flowers are small, yellow.
Of particular interest are the fruits of duchenea, similar to strawberries. They are not edible, but they perfectly perform a decorative function.
Arenaria crimson. Due to its unpretentiousness, it is often used in the creation of alpine slides and rockeries. It can even grow on rocks and sand. Easily tolerates drought, so frequent watering is not required.
The shoots of arenaria are painted crimson, their height is not more than 15 cm. Flowers — asterisks are white or pale pink.
Balkan geranium. Bushes 25 cm high have carved bright green leaves. The foliage also looks impressive in the autumn, when it turns yellow or red.
Even in winter, the leaves do not fall, so geraniums are used to decorate the garden all year round. Flowering continues from June to September. Peduncles of red or purple hue have a pleasant aroma.
Juniper horizontalis a representative of non-flowering stunted plants. The dwarf variety Blue Chip is suitable for the garden. The color of the prickly leaves — the needles are blue, dense. Juniper should be planted in well-lit areas, the soil can be any.
annual plants
Low-growing annual flowers are distinguished by their brightness and variety. Seeds need to be sown every year. But it is possible during the planting season to quickly create an updated design of the flower bed.
Purslane has leaves in the form of large needles that spread along the ground, creating a «carpet». Therefore, gardeners often call this flower «mat». Flowers are simple and double, depending on the variety of the plant.
Purslane can grow in sandy, rocky soil, drought-resistant. He needs the sun. The color range of inflorescences is huge: white, pink, yellow, red, orange, burgundy shades.
Petunia is a favorite of landscape designers due to the variety of varieties that differ in shape and color. The plant requires certain planting and care conditions.
It is necessary to regularly loosen and fertilize the soil, as well as water the petunias. At the same time, overmoistening, which is detrimental to specimens with double inflorescences, should be avoided.
Calceolaria is a beautiful and unusual flower native to South America. Original inflorescences — shoes can have a yellow, orange, red or white color with dark strokes. The diameter of the flowers is 6 cm, the height of the plant does not exceed 45 cm.
Feeding with universal fertilizers is necessary. It is also necessary to ensure that calceolaria is not affected by aphids, as this disease is common for this plant species.
Iberis (Iberian, stennik) is a flower with simple leaves and small flowers. Inflorescences form umbrellas of white (for bitter iberis), pink or purple (for umbrella species) hue. Peduncles have a pleasant smell.
After flowering, a pod with seeds is formed, which can be used for planting. The sun-loving stennik can be planted in stony soil or loam (soil with a high proportion of clay and sand). Does not require frequent watering, drought-resistant.
biennial plants
Biennial flowers, as the name suggests, will bloom for two years. They are frost-resistant, but they need to be covered for the winter. This group includes cheerful pansies, beautiful Wittrock violets (known as «pansies»), delicate daisies, touching forget-me-nots. These small plants, no more than 20 cm high, are ideal flowers for a flower bed.
When creating a mixborder composition, it is recommended to use combinations of the types described. In this case, it is necessary to take into account the compatibility of plants, which is determined by:
- the necessary composition of the soil
- growth rate
- watering frequency
- light-loving or shade preference.
The specified parameters must match for plants located in the same flower bed.
Each photo of undersized flowers confirms the originality and beauty of these plants. In order for the effectiveness of the flower bed to be maintained throughout the season, you must follow the rules of care:
- Remove faded flowers
- Make fences out of rocks or plastic to keep the roots from growing excessively.
- Take into account the growth rate of plants, do not plant flowers close to the border
- Create a drip irrigation system
- Use spruce branches or modern materials for shelter for the winter.
